Comment About the Building
It`s a white brick, postwar building with a full time staff and basement laundry and a garage. The daytime doorman is a contractor; he does a lot of renovations in apartments.
Reasonable board only requires 20% down payment and there is no flip tax. There`s a normal application with nothing unusual. Pets permitted.
Because the building is in the PS 158 school district the building has a lot of families with young children. It is also not far from Carl Schurz Park and the East River promenade. The closest subway is 3 blocks away at Lexington Avenue & 77th Street; the up & downtown bus runs on 1st Avenue. There are many reasonable restaurants in the area.
